HOW TO BE A GOOD STORYTELLER? GREECE
Storytelling rules when telling a story in front of an audience:
*Speak slowly and clearly
*Change your voice
*Be courageous in front of the audience
*Make movements with your hands..
...your legs or your body (or mime)
*Be prepared!

HOW TO BE A GOOD STORYTELLER? CROATIA
"Our 4th graders, led by their class teacher Marijana Haramija, had a discussion, on rules "How to be a good storyteller". They collected their conclusions and created a poster.
Here are their conclusions: A good storyteller must be:
- interesting;
- original;
- playful;
- good at expressing oneself;
- good at getting into a story;
- confident - without stage fright; 
- likes to act;
- likes to make jokes"
